Overview

(S)-1-Phenylethanol is an enantiomerically pure chiral alcohol that serves as a fundamental building block in asymmetric synthesis. As part of the secondary alcohol family, it features a stereocenter at the α-carbon, making it valuable for producing optically active compounds. The (S)-configuration is particularly significant in pharmaceutical manufacturing where specific stereochemistry is required for drug efficacy. Industrial production typically involves asymmetric reduction of acetophenone or kinetic resolution of racemic mixtures. Its high enantioselectivity (often >99% ee) and stability under various reaction conditions have established it as a preferred chiral auxiliary in fine chemical synthesis.

Physical and Chemical Properties

The compound exhibits characteristic physical properties of aromatic alcohols, including moderate volatility and a faint floral odor. Its optical rotation of −45° (neat) serves as a key identifier for quality control. The hydroxyl group enables typical alcohol reactions like esterification and oxidation, while the phenyl ring allows electrophilic aromatic substitutions. Chemically, (S)-1-Phenylethanol demonstrates stability under anhydrous conditions but may racemize in strongly acidic or basic environments. Its partition coefficient (log P ≈ 1.4) indicates moderate lipophilicity, influencing solubility in organic solvents. The compound’s vapor pressure (0.1 mmHg at 20°C) warrants proper ventilation during handling.

Main Applications

In pharmaceuticals, (S)-1-Phenylethanol functions as a chiral intermediate for β-blockers, antidepressants, and antiviral drugs. Its ability to induce stereoselectivity makes it indispensable in asymmetric hydrogenations and enzyme-mediated transformations. The fragrance industry utilizes its mild rose-like aroma in perfumes and flavor compositions. As a resolving agent, it effectively separates racemic acids via diastereomeric salt formation. Recent applications include use in liquid crystals and as a ligand in transition metal catalysis. The electronics sector employs it in chiral dopants for LCD materials, where optical purity directly impacts performance.

Safety and Storage

Classified as a Category 3 flammable liquid, (S)-1-Phenylethanol requires storage in tightly sealed containers with inert gas padding when appropriate. Incompatible with strong oxidizers and acids, it should be kept in corrosion-resistant cabinets at temperatures below 30°C. Secondary containment is recommended for bulk quantities. Personal protective equipment including chemical-resistant gloves (nitrile recommended) and splash goggles should be used. Spills should be absorbed with inert material and disposed as hazardous waste. Proper grounding is essential during transfer due to electrostatic accumulation risk (resistivity: 3.6 × 10^7 Ω·cm).

B2B Procurement Guide

Industrial buyers should prioritize suppliers who provide comprehensive certificates of analysis including chiral HPLC traces, residual solvent profiles, and water content. Pharmaceutical-grade material typically requires ≥99% chemical purity and ≥99.5% enantiomeric excess. Bulk shipments (drum quantities) often offer 15-30% cost savings compared to lab-scale packaging. Just-in-time procurement is advisable due to potential racemization during prolonged storage. Quality verification through independent chiral GC or polarimetry is recommended upon receipt. For continuous supply, consider dual sourcing from manufacturers in China and Europe to mitigate supply chain risks.
